This year marks a quarter century of Applecross Rotary’s annual Jacaranda Festival, from humble beginnings at Heathcote reserve, it was moved to its current village retail setting, under the jacarandas, in Ardross Street, Applecross in 2002 and is now recognised as one of Perth’s foremost street festivals.
The festival has continued to evolve, attracting family based crowds of 12 – 15,000 to enjoy the wonderful activities of the day, and this year, the 25th, will indeed be a special celebration. So many volunteer groups assist on the day, joining in the fun and helping to fly the Rotary Community Service flag loud and strong.
New this year, on an expanded event site will be a new kids activities zone, a fresh line up of entertainers and street theatre, a special ‘busker central’ feature, new food offers and a Vintage Fire Truck offering rides around the streets adorned with full on flowering jacarandas!
More than 150 artisan quality street stalls, covered eating and rest zones along with the non stop entertainment in the main marquee and the regular kids features help make this day so really special.

Applecross Rotary is grateful for the main event sponsors, Lotterywest and The City of Melville who have supported the festival for more than 20 years, and club sponsors The Good Grocer, Mont Property, Pharmacy777 and Ross North Homes for standing with Rotary for the past 10 years.
